## Deploying the Gatewick Proctor Queue

Deploys are pretty painless: push to main, wait for the pipeline, then watch the queue drain dashboard for five minutes. If candidates pile up mid-exam, roll back first and ask questions later — the queue replays safely. Everything the workers care about lives in one config block, shown here for reference.

settings of bafof-yagef:
JOROX_PIN=8740
JOROX_TENANT=pelox
JOROX_METRICS_HOST=metrics.jorox.qorvelworks.internal
JOROX_SEAL=seal_c78f63c1
JOROX_STANDBY_TEAM=norax

Action item from the Mirewater tide-table widget incident. Owner: release manager. Widget cached stale harbor offsets after the DST change, showing tides six hours off for two days. Required: add a cache-invalidation check to the release checklist, block deploys when offset tables are older than 24 hours, and verify the Saltgate harbor feed before each cut. Deadline: next release. Checklist template and sign-off procedure are documented on the internal page below.

wiki page, kawif-bajep: https://artifactory.zarqelforge.internal/issue/browse/display/display/projects/spaces/secrets/000fe6ec5a46af29355003e1

MEMO — Sales Leads

Warranty costs on the Fennel-9 line ran 34% over plan last quarter. Root cause: gasket failures from the Ostermark batch. Claims are trending down but margin impact hits your Q4 targets. Do not discount service contracts until further notice. Tobin will circulate revised quotas Friday. The related business-plan adjustment is noted below.

confidential, kagep-kahof: Druokax Systems plans to lower the Ulaath list price by 53 percent in March.

Papercrane renders customer-facing PDF invoices and runs in the Selwick production cell. Normal deploys and restarts go through the Ferryline pipeline; break-glass access exists only for cases where the pipeline itself is down and invoices are failing to generate. To invoke it, open the break-glass console from the on-call bastion, select the Papercrane service, and acknowledge the audit banner. The console will then prompt for the sealed recovery passphrase, which is recorded below for on-call use.

vault phrase of bagef-bagep = oliix-holdor